In this episode of the Weekly Finance News Wrap with Paige Estritori, key events within the finance sector are discussed. The segment opens with ANZ receiving regulatory approval for their acquisition of Suncorp Bank, despite some resistance. Experts anticipate potential changes in Suncorp's rates following the merger. Meanwhile, financial influencer Canna Campbell has been ordered to pay for infringing on Rhondalynn Korolak's trademark, igniting debate on ethical standards among financial advisors. There has been a noticeable increase in banking code violations this year, including a major blunder from an undisclosed bank causing a $12 million impact, causing banks to reevaluate their oversight protocols. A legal case has been launched by Echo Law against Toyota Finance for charging high interest rates via "flex commissions" between 2010 and 2018. The report ends with insight on further legal actions against financial institutions.
